After four days' cycling in glorious weather from their home in Pill, North Somerset Jenni Buck and her dad, Bob were given a surprise welcome by Rupert Wilson, General Manager of Rick Stein's Seafood Restaurant in Padstow.
The 250 mile epic along the Sustrans West Country Way was sponsored to raise funds for the West of England MS Therapy Centre.
Despite the hot weather the pair rode up 1 in 4 hills over Exmoor then followed the Tarka Trail and the Camel Trail, covering between 50 and & 70 miles a day.
"This was a fabulous adventure" says Jenni "It was really hard work but the stunning scenery and wonderful welcome we received all the way made it easy"
"Despite having been diagnosed with MS 11 years ago Jen doesn't allow it to stop her" says Bob " I am so proud of her doing what a lot of younger people wouldn't even consider"
The pair have already raised over £5,000 towards the running costs of the MS Centre - but are still willing to accept donations.
We are raising funds for the West of England MS Therapy Centre, Nailsea which provides fantastic therapies and support for those diagnosed with Multiple Sclerosis and their families.
